En truecrypt hdd kan jeg ikke mere mounte og bruge. Hdd'en er måske blevet beskadiget pga et strømstik, der ikke virkede korrekt. Derfor brugte jeg et boot shred program til at slette hdd'en. Og programmet kontrollerer samtidig, om hdd'en har skrivefejl.
Det er en 2tb hdd. Da kontrollen var færdig, meddelte shred programmet, at 3907029168 sektorer var blevet kontrolleret, og der var 55 skrivefejl. En skrivefejl er en sektor med fejl?
Shred programmet meddelte også, at 3907029168 sektorer var blevet slettet, dvs overskrevet.
Jeg har også prøvet at kontrollere hdd'en med programmet 'disks'. Programmet melder 'self-test failed'.
Mit spørgsmål er, om hdd'en kan bruges til noget, eller skal i skraldespanden? Hvis jeg fortsat kan bruge hdd'en, hvordan formatterer jeg den? Kan jeg bruge hdd'en til trucrypt volumes? Hvordan ved jeg, hvor store truecrypt volumes, jeg kan oprette på hdd'en?
Tak.
Skal en hdd med skrivefejl i affaldsspanden?
-
- Admin
- Indlæg: 20878
- Tilmeldt: 15. nov 2009, 15:04
- IRC nickname: AJenbo
- Geografisk sted: Vanløse, København
Re: Skal en hdd med skrivefejl i affaldsspanden?
Fejl på disken er aldrig et godt tegn, men det betyder ikke nødvendigvis at resten af disken vil begynde at fejle. Personligt ville jeg dog ikke bruge den til noget vigtigt og alt efter hvordan tc virker kan små fejl betyde store data tab.
Re: Skal en hdd med skrivefejl i affaldsspanden?
Tak for svar.
Skal jeg formattere den almindeligt med gparted?
Hvis jeg har regnet rigtigt, er hver sektor 1/2kb. Hvis hver skrivefejl er en defekt sektor, er det omkring 25kb af hdd'en, der er defekt. Dvs jeg burde kunne oprette en truecrypt container på næsten hdd'ens størrelse, eller måske er det bedre at oprette flere mindre på fx 500gb?
Er der et program, der kan vise hvor meget af hdd'en, der er defekt?
Skal jeg formattere den almindeligt med gparted?
Hvis jeg har regnet rigtigt, er hver sektor 1/2kb. Hvis hver skrivefejl er en defekt sektor, er det omkring 25kb af hdd'en, der er defekt. Dvs jeg burde kunne oprette en truecrypt container på næsten hdd'ens størrelse, eller måske er det bedre at oprette flere mindre på fx 500gb?
Er der et program, der kan vise hvor meget af hdd'en, der er defekt?
-
- Admin
- Indlæg: 20878
- Tilmeldt: 15. nov 2009, 15:04
- IRC nickname: AJenbo
- Geografisk sted: Vanløse, København
Re: Skal en hdd med skrivefejl i affaldsspanden?
Disk værktøjet i Ubuntu kan vise dig helbreds status for disken. Det er ikke sådan at alle defekte sektor ligger samlet et stedet så du kan ikke være sikker på at få noget ud af at partitioner disken på en bestemt måde. Jeg kender ikke til TC, men EXT4 har mulighed for at kortlægge de defekte sektor og der med undgå dem i fremtiden, men det kræver at disken scannes efter disken er blevet formateret, og at defekten ikke ligger i MBR
-
- Admin
- Indlæg: 20878
- Tilmeldt: 15. nov 2009, 15:04
- IRC nickname: AJenbo
- Geografisk sted: Vanløse, København
Re: Skal en hdd med skrivefejl i affaldsspanden?
Jeg vil også forslå du bruger en krypterings måde der er indbygget i linux frem for tc
@mcrypto du fik da tidligere root adgang til dist system, har du glem din kode igen?
@mcrypto du fik da tidligere root adgang til dist system, har du glem din kode igen?
-
- Indlæg: 2246
- Tilmeldt: 12. feb 2011, 13:22
- IRC nickname: How to be me
Re: Skal en hdd med skrivefejl i affaldsspanden?
mcrypto skrev:p.s. ikke shred, brug ddrescue. du skal bytte din disk, den er vel ikke over garantiperioden. du kan (MEGET måske) trimme din disk med hdparms diverse fix/fax/flip funktioner. men ikke engang jeg vil råde dig til at gøre, den failer bare igen. dumme disk. du skal bruge smart på den. kan ikke lige huske hvordan man starter det fordi jeg ikke har root (endnu).
Under Diske i programmer er der et tandhjulssymbol at trykke på, så kommer Smart-funktionen frem.
Når lejligheden byder sig.
Re: Skal en hdd med skrivefejl i affaldsspanden?
Tak for svarene.
Jeg bruger truecrypt, fordi jeg kan finde ud af det. Kryptering på linux kender jeg ikke.
Jeg har prøvet dette.
http://www.youtube.com/watch?v=Ay9AKBO8rsI
Ved at se en anden youtube video startede jeg denne command sudo badblocks -vs /dev/sdb > badblocksresult
Jeg skrev -vs, fordi derved kan man se progress og hvor lang tid, som command'en har kørt. Jeg mener ikke, at command'en er særlig brugbar, fordi at finde bad blocks tager flere dage for en 2tb hdd.
Da command'en var færdig, havde den fundet 21 errors.
Herefter skrev jeg sudo fsck -t ext4 -l badblocksresult /dev/sdb
Men jeg mener ikke det betød, at der blev udført en handling. I stedet kom dette resultat fsck.ext4 [-panyrcdfvtDFV] [-b superblock] [-B blocksize]
[-I inode_buffer_blocks] [-P process_inode_size]
[-l|-L bad_blocks_file] [-C fd] [-j external_journal]
[-E extended-options] device
Emergency help:
-p Automatic repair (no questions)
-n Make no changes to the filesystem
-y Assume "yes" to all questions
-c Check for bad blocks and add them to the badblock list
-f Force checking even if filesystem is marked clean
-v Be verbose
-b superblock Use alternative superblock
-B blocksize Force blocksize when looking for superblock
-j external_journal Set location of the external journal
-l bad_blocks_file Add to badblocks list
-L bad_blocks_file Set badblocks list
Men er det ikke en liste af commands?
Når jeg ser disse lister fx i ubuntu wiki, kan jeg ikke bruge dem. Jeg kan ud fra listen ikke se, hvad jeg skal skrive for at få et bestemt resultat.
Forslag til, hvad jeg skal skrive for at kunne bruge hdd'en?
Efter at have brugt commands
sudo badblocks -vs /dev/sdb > badblocksresult og
sudo fsck -t ext4 -l badblocksresult /dev/sdb
udførte jeg hdd testen i programmet 'disks' igen. Med testen indstillet til 'short' kommer der ikke en fejlmelding. Men ved 90% bliver testen hængende, og den afsluttes ikke.
Dvs der må fortsat være fejl ved hdd'en?
Jeg bruger truecrypt, fordi jeg kan finde ud af det. Kryptering på linux kender jeg ikke.
Jeg har prøvet dette.
http://www.youtube.com/watch?v=Ay9AKBO8rsI
Ved at se en anden youtube video startede jeg denne command sudo badblocks -vs /dev/sdb > badblocksresult
Jeg skrev -vs, fordi derved kan man se progress og hvor lang tid, som command'en har kørt. Jeg mener ikke, at command'en er særlig brugbar, fordi at finde bad blocks tager flere dage for en 2tb hdd.
Da command'en var færdig, havde den fundet 21 errors.
Herefter skrev jeg sudo fsck -t ext4 -l badblocksresult /dev/sdb
Men jeg mener ikke det betød, at der blev udført en handling. I stedet kom dette resultat fsck.ext4 [-panyrcdfvtDFV] [-b superblock] [-B blocksize]
[-I inode_buffer_blocks] [-P process_inode_size]
[-l|-L bad_blocks_file] [-C fd] [-j external_journal]
[-E extended-options] device
Emergency help:
-p Automatic repair (no questions)
-n Make no changes to the filesystem
-y Assume "yes" to all questions
-c Check for bad blocks and add them to the badblock list
-f Force checking even if filesystem is marked clean
-v Be verbose
-b superblock Use alternative superblock
-B blocksize Force blocksize when looking for superblock
-j external_journal Set location of the external journal
-l bad_blocks_file Add to badblocks list
-L bad_blocks_file Set badblocks list
Men er det ikke en liste af commands?
Når jeg ser disse lister fx i ubuntu wiki, kan jeg ikke bruge dem. Jeg kan ud fra listen ikke se, hvad jeg skal skrive for at få et bestemt resultat.
Forslag til, hvad jeg skal skrive for at kunne bruge hdd'en?
Efter at have brugt commands
sudo badblocks -vs /dev/sdb > badblocksresult og
sudo fsck -t ext4 -l badblocksresult /dev/sdb
udførte jeg hdd testen i programmet 'disks' igen. Med testen indstillet til 'short' kommer der ikke en fejlmelding. Men ved 90% bliver testen hængende, og den afsluttes ikke.
Dvs der må fortsat være fejl ved hdd'en?
-
- Admin
- Indlæg: 20878
- Tilmeldt: 15. nov 2009, 15:04
- IRC nickname: AJenbo
- Geografisk sted: Vanløse, København
Re: Skal en hdd med skrivefejl i affaldsspanden?
gtr skrev:Jeg bruger truecrypt, fordi jeg kan finde ud af det. Kryptering på linux kender jeg ikke.
Tid til at lære noget nyt. Åben programmet Diske, marker drevet, tryk på de 2 tandhjul under Diskenheder, vælge Formater, vælge "Krypteret" som type, skriv en adgangskode og tryk på formater.
gtr skrev:Men er det ikke en liste af commands?
Jo, de fleste terminal programmer udskriver hjælpe siden når de får en kommando der ikke giver mening.
gtr skrev:ved 90% bliver testen hængende, og den afsluttes ikke.
Dvs der må fortsat være fejl ved hdd'en?
At mappe bad blocks får dem ikke til at gå væk men fåre styre systemet til at undgå dem frem over. Desuden har du ikke mappet dem men kun konstateret dem.
Den lettest måde er at lade fsck håndtere det hele, du kommer godt nok til at skulle vendte på den scanner disken igen:
Kode: Vælg alt
sudo fsck -c /dev/sdb
Re: Skal en hdd med skrivefejl i affaldsspanden?
Tak for svar.
Dvs sudo fsck -c /dev/sdb er det eneste, som jeg skal bruge?
Dvs sudo fsck -c /dev/sdb er det eneste, som jeg skal bruge?
-
- Admin
- Indlæg: 20878
- Tilmeldt: 15. nov 2009, 15:04
- IRC nickname: AJenbo
- Geografisk sted: Vanløse, København
Re: Skal en hdd med skrivefejl i affaldsspanden?
Ja, måske skal du dog skrive hvilken partion du vil scanne frem for hele disken, eks.:
Kode: Vælg alt
sudo fsck -c /dev/sdb1
Re: Skal en hdd med skrivefejl i affaldsspanden?
Jeg har gennemført sudo fsck -c /dev/sdb1
Det tog kortere tid, omkring et halvt døgn. Tilsyneladende skriver command'en ikke, hvor mange fejl den har fundet, når den slutter. Men på et tidspunkt viste den 10 errors.
Slutmeldingen var denne
$ sudo fsck -c /dev/sdb1
fsck from util-linux 2.20.1
e2fsck 1.42.9 (4-Feb-2014)
Checking for bad blocks (read-only test): 0.00% done, 0:00 elapsed. (0/0/0 errdone
green: Updating bad block inode.
Pass 1: Checking inodes, blocks, and sizes
Pass 2: Checking directory structure
Pass 3: Checking directory connectivity
Pass 4: Checking reference counts
Pass 5: Checking group summary information
green: ***** FILE SYSTEM WAS MODIFIED *****
green: 11/122101760 files (0.0% non-contiguous), 7713429/488378368 blocks
$
Kan hdd'en bruges nu?
Kan jeg få forklaret, hvad det, der står efter 'green', betyder?
Det tog kortere tid, omkring et halvt døgn. Tilsyneladende skriver command'en ikke, hvor mange fejl den har fundet, når den slutter. Men på et tidspunkt viste den 10 errors.
Slutmeldingen var denne
$ sudo fsck -c /dev/sdb1
fsck from util-linux 2.20.1
e2fsck 1.42.9 (4-Feb-2014)
Checking for bad blocks (read-only test): 0.00% done, 0:00 elapsed. (0/0/0 errdone
green: Updating bad block inode.
Pass 1: Checking inodes, blocks, and sizes
Pass 2: Checking directory structure
Pass 3: Checking directory connectivity
Pass 4: Checking reference counts
Pass 5: Checking group summary information
green: ***** FILE SYSTEM WAS MODIFIED *****
green: 11/122101760 files (0.0% non-contiguous), 7713429/488378368 blocks
$
Kan hdd'en bruges nu?
Kan jeg få forklaret, hvad det, der står efter 'green', betyder?